Crumlin Road Area - Compulsory Purchase Order
June 1, 1949
County Borough of Dublin
Housing of the Working Classes Acts, 1890 to 1948,
Housing (Financial and Miscellaneous Provisions) Acts, 1932 to 1948
CRUMLIN ROAD AREA COMPULSORY PURCHASE ORDER, 1949
NOTICE is hereby given that the Right Honourable the Lord Mayor, Aldermen, and Burgesses of Dublin (hereinafter called “the Corporation”), in pursuance of the powers vested in them by Part III of the Housing of the Working Classes Act, 1890, on the 21st day of May, 1949, made an Order which will be submitted for confirmation by the Minister for Local Government, authorising them to purchase compulsorily, for the purpose of Part III of the Housing of the Working Classes Act, 1890, the lands described in the Schedule hereto.
A copy of the said Order and of the map referred to therein has been deposited at the office of the Dublin City Manager and Town Clerk, City Hall, Dublin, and may be seen at all reasonable hours.
